White Pig Falls A 96-meter-high waterfall in the Prefectural Nature Park of the Saragamine Mountain Range. It hangs over the upper reaches of the Shigenobu River, in the valley of the Omote River, and its falling appearance makes you feel the greatness of Nature. White Boar Falls shows various faces in Four Seasons. Fresh greenery sprouts in Spring, in early summer it is a refreshing summer resort, and in autumn the trees surrounding the waterfall are dyed in brocade. Soseki and Shiki were also Fascination, and it There are a record of their visits. Especially the winter scenery is fantastic. When the bitter cold lasts for several days, the entire waterfall looks like an ice sculpture. "Uenohara Ruins of the Castle" This is the view from Mt. Gozen in the early 1955 (Showa 30)'s century. The circled area in the center of the photo is where Uenohara Castle was located. The moat on the west side had been filled in before the central road was built, but the moat-enclosed land called the river terrace would have been a great place to keep the enemy out. It is the residence of the Furugori clan of the Heian period and the Kato clan of the Sengoku period.

Sightseeing spot introduction Tarumae Garo (Toma Komaki City) The Sightseeing spot in June is Tarumae Garo! Everyone, Garrow? That's right, isn't it? "Gallow" means "a place where a river streams between narrow sheer cliffs." Indeed, here in the Tarumae Garo, the sheer rocks show a unique landscape, and the rock surface is covered with dark green moss, which is like a velvety carpet and is a very beautiful place. It is located in a forest at the foothills of Mt. Mt. Tarumae, which has been designated as a Nature Conservation District in 1979 (Showa 54) in the city's Nature Conservation District, and in June, when the fresh greenery season begins, the early summer sunlight reaches the deep riverbed, showing the most beautiful scenery of the year. There is Car parking lot, so you can easily stop by Car! Surrounded by greenery and the sound of the river streaming, this place is a healing spot that will make you forget the summer heat and the hustle and bustle of daily life, so please come and visit us in the coming season! * The surrounding mountain forests It is also one of habitats for wild animals including brown bears. Please refrain from entering the forest in the morning and evening when brown bears are active. * In the past, it was possible to go down to the river, but now please do not go down to the river due to the risk of bedrock collapse

Fukoji Temple Hydrangeas ❚ Bloom Status as of June 13, 2025 Fukoji Temple stands in Asaji Town, Bungo-Ono, Oita Prefecture. It is famous as a hydrangea sightseeing spot. The hydrangeas are currently about 70–80% in bloom. They should reach peak bloom this weekend. This year there are fewer flowers than usual, but each one blooms beautifully. We will update the bloom status as it progresses. Location: Kamiozuka, Asaji Town, Bungo-Ono, Oita Prefecture Access: About a 10-minute drive from JR Asaji Station Parking: Available (free) Toilets: Available ❚ Fukoji Temple The stone-carved Buddha on the temple grounds, including its base, measures about 11 meters tall and is one of Japan’s largest cliff carvings. The central, giant figure is Fudo Myoo. Fudo Myoo usually appears with an angry expression, but years of wind and rain have softened this carving into a rounded, gentle face. Though large, this Fudo Myoo has a very approachable presence. Fukoji is also known as Hydrangea Temple because so many hydrangeas are planted there. During the rainy season you can see numerous hydrangea blooms alongside the cliff carving. A mountain-opening Shinto ceremony to pray for safety took place at the summit of Mt. Tarumae on June 12th. A newly installed information board now includes an English description. Mt. Tarumae stands at 1,041 meters and is considered relatively easy to climb. Some hikers are seen wearing sandals, thin-soled sneakers, or short sleeves and shorts, but we recommend trekking shoes and a windbreaker. (The trails are slippery due to pumice ejected during past eruptions, and strong winds always blow at the summit.)

<Atosanupuri Trekking Tour> Atosanupuri, whose name means “bare mountain” in the Ainu language. About 1,500 fumaroles and the beautiful yellow sulfur crystals that spread around them have been designated Teshikaga’s "Specified Natural Tourism Resource," and the mountain is a restricted access area under Article 19 of the Ecotourism Promotion Act. If you are seeking a special and rare trekking experience, please join us. Advance reservations are required, so don’t forget to book!
